Transaction 870192d323928162a3ea86ecfed9aeb7ee94666d05041c39efa7e7bf11ff8108
1 Input
2 Outputs
- 870192d323928162a3ea86ecfed9aeb7ee94666d05041c39efa7e7bf11ff8108:0
- 870192d323928162a3ea86ecfed9aeb7ee94666d05041c39efa7e7bf11ff8108:1
value 235000
address 33wfEeK5oiDionBCjYT6EBYA4E4xc1RF2B
value 464897
address 13LePRokCSttQHcPbMpqvrDgqTpjDXabYd